What Is a Guest Speaker?
A thought leader is an invited expert, leader, author, executive, or professional who presents at an event to educate, inspire, entertain, or inform an audience.
Famous guest speakers may deliver:
Keynote presentations
Fireside chats
Panel discussions
Workshops
Executive briefings
Training sessions
Q&A sessions
Roundtable discussions
Versus internal presenters, global guest speakers provide independent perspectives and specialized expertise that can enhance an event’s value.

How to Choose the Right Guest Speaker
Before selecting a speaker, consider:
Event Objectives
Ask:
Should attendees be inspired?
Should they learn practical skills?
Is the goal leadership development?
Are you introducing organizational change?
Audience
Evaluate:
Industry
Experience level
Professional interests
Organizational challenges
Speaker Expertise
Review:
Career achievements
Speaking experience
Publications
Industry knowledge
Presentation Style
Some speakers focus on:
Inspiration
Education
Entertainment
Strategy
Interactive learning
Choose the style that best fits your event.

Future Trends in Guest Speaking
The guest speaking industry continues to evolve alongside changing business needs.
Emerging trends include:
Increased demand for AI and technology speakers
More customized presentations tailored to organizational goals
Hybrid and virtual speaking engagements
Interactive audience participation using digital tools
Extended engagements that combine keynotes with workshops and advisory sessions
Organizations are increasingly seeking speakers who can deliver actionable insights rather than inspirational stories alone.
